About Zhongfu Tan

Zhongfu Tan is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Energy Engineering and Power Technology, Control and Systems Engineering, Management Science and Operations Research and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, having authored 230 papers that have together received 6.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Integrated Energy Systems Optimization (79 papers), Smart Grid Energy Management (73 papers), Electric Power System Optimization (61 papers), Energy Load and Power Forecasting (40 papers), Microgrid Control and Optimization (32 papers), Power Systems and Renewable Energy (26 papers), Hybrid Renewable Energy Systems (21 papers) and Electric Vehicles and Infrastructure (19 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Energy Engineering and Power Technology (726 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(4.4k citations), Management Science and Operations Research (682 citations), Control and Systems Engineering (1.2k citations) and General Energy (48 citations). Zhongfu Tan has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Pakistan. Frequent co-authors include Liwei Ju, Jinliang Zhang, Qingkun Tan, Yi‐Ming Wei, Jianhui Wang, Gejirifu De, Huanhuan Li, Jianjun Wang, Jun Xu and Hongyu Lin. Their work appears in journals such as Energies, Sustainability, Energy, Journal of Cleaner Production and Applied Energy.
